This document is a learning brief on resilient community health systems, specifically focusing on the experiences and lessons learned from the USAID Nawiri project in Kenya.
USAID, USAID Nawiri · 2022

Abstract
The brief highlights the importance of investing in strong and resilient community health systems to improve and maintain nutrition and health outcomes, particularly in the context of shocks and stresses. It presents five key insights from the project's research and learning agenda, including the potential of family-led mid-upper arm circumference (FL-MUAC) and integrated community case management-community-based management of acute malnutrition (iCCM-CMAM) to strengthen resilience capacities, the need to address systemic dysfunctionalities impeding the ability of community health volunteers to fulfill their potential, and the importance of better integration and communication across the various tiers of the health system. The brief concludes by outlining priority areas for ongoing learning and adaptation.
